A man and woman have died in an Aberdeenshire crash which also left four in hospital, including two young children.
Emergency services were called around 7.25pm on Saturday to a crash between Toll of Birness and Mintlaw at Clola on the A952 that involved a grey Land Rover Evoque and a black Vauxhall Corsa.
They attended and a 24-year-old man, a passenger in the Corsa, was pronounced dead at the scene.

The crash happened between Toll of Birness and Mintlaw at Clola on the A952. | GoogleThe occupants of the Evoque, a man aged 62 and a woman aged 61, were taken to Aberdeen Royal Infirmary for treatment.
Their condition is currently unknown.

Two boys aged seven and five in the car were also taken to hospital as a precaution.
The road was closed for crash investigation work.

Sergeant Pete Henderson said: “Our thoughts are with the families of those who died and everyone affected by this incident.
“Our enquiries are ongoing to establish the full circumstances and we are keen to speak to anyone who may have seen what happened.
“We are also asking anyone driving in the area around the time of the crash to please check any dash-cam footage they have to see if it has captured something that could assist with our investigation.
“Anyone who can help is asked to contact Police Scotland on 101, quoting incident number 2697 of Saturday, December 6.”
